Contact monitoring apparatus for a three-pole changeover contact

1. A contact monitoring device for monitoring an electrical, three-pole changeover contact, comprising:
a signal generator, which is configured to generate a monitoring signal;
a coupling device, which is connected downstream from the signal generator;
a sensing circuit, which is connected downstream from the coupling device and which is coupled or can be coupled to the changeover contact,
wherein the sensing circuit comprises one or several impedances and is configured to provide, at the coupling device, a total impedance, which varies with a switch position of the changeover contact,
wherein the monitoring signal generation of the signal generator and thus the monitoring signal and/or a signal derived from the monitoring signal can be changed as a function of a switching position of the changeover contact by means of the sensing circuit, which is coupled to the signal generator via the coupling device;
an evaluation device, which is configured to detect the monitoring signal and/or the signal derived from the monitoring signal and/or a change of the monitoring signal and/or a change of the signal derived from the monitoring signal, in order to thus monitor the changeover contact,
wherein the sensing circuit is configured to change a resonance state of the signal generator, as a changed resonance state, for the monitoring signal and/or the signal derived from the monitoring signal in a different way for at least three different switch positions of the changeover contact.
